Validic is a market-leading digital health and remote care company devoted to its mission of improving the quality of life by making personal data actionable.
Validic® guides healthcare organizations through the complexities associated with accessing and operationalizing personal health data.
Validic was founded in 2010 by Ryan Beckland and Drew Schiller. The company is headquartered in Durham, North Carolina.
Validic built the world's largest health IoT platform to transform personal data into insights and actions that improve healthcare delivery, strengthen relationships and empower people to play an active role in their health and well-being.
Validic supports the largest remote patient monitoring program in the country, with more than 250,000 enrolled patients since inception and 6,000 referring providers across commercially insured and Medicare populations.
Validic's digital health platform has 540+ supported devices, including Accu-Chek, Apple Health, Dexcom, FitBit, Garmin, Google Health, iHealth, Misfit, Omron, Samsung Health, Strava, Withings, Zewa, and more, with more than 15 billion annual data transactions.
Validic is backed by Kaiser Permanente Ventures, Mark Cuban, Greycroft Partners, Arkin Digital Health, Green Park & Golf Ventures, SJF Ventures, Ziegler, Gore Range Capital, and others. The company raised $12M in a new round on Nov 14, 2022. This brings Validic's total funding to $30.4M to date.
